The Tools for Successful Vaccine Tracking
With technology at our fingertips, there are now more resources than ever to assist with vaccine tracking. From smartphone apps that send reminders about upcoming shots to digital health records that store your vaccination history, these tools help streamline the process. They not only help individuals stay organized but also provide reassurance in knowing that no crucial vaccinations will be missed.
Community Immunity and Collective Responsibility
Effective vaccine tracking goes beyond individual health. As a community, we share the responsibility of protecting each other through vaccinations. When individuals keep track of their immunizations, they contribute to the larger concept of herd immunity, which is vital for public health. Understanding the interconnectedness of personal health with community health fosters a sense of responsibility and solidarity among neighbors.
